Anyone ever had an issue where during Initail Height Sensing with float head the Z axis goes down to find the surface of the material clicks the limit switch but does not retract back up, it just continues diving into the material (causing the torch to pop out of its clamp) ???
First thought was the limit switch was shorting due to plasma dust or loose wire etc. but I can see it light up on the diagnostic window when doing Initial Height Sensing so the limit switch is actually working.
I thought it was a Mach3 problem but this also recently started to happen with UCCNC, I am now guessing it might be an issue with the MP1000 thc post I'm ussing from Sheetcam.
I also noticed but have not verified is that when I zero all aixs before starting a job and if the Z axis is more than 1/4" off the top of the material the issue is most likely to happen.
Any ideas??

Re: IHS not working as it should
With the MP1000-THC post the touch off is a Home move . A home is supposed to stop and retract the switchOffset distance then the G-code resets the Z DRO to zero and then it lifts from there to pierce height. Go to Single step mode in MACH and run one line of code at a time and see where it fails. If it never does, suspect that the swtich may be noisy or "chattering" and multiple inputs on a switch can cause it to not do the function.

Re: IHS not working as it should
Ok the problem seems to be my breakout board. Pin 12 for the floating head switch is not working even after replacing the limit switch or shorting the pins directly on the breakout board.
